Описание тега pytz
NonePytz переносит базу данных Olson tz в Python. Эта библиотека позволяет производить точные и кросс-платформенные вычисления часовых поясов с использованием Python 2.3 или выше. Это также решает проблему неоднозначного времени в конце летнего времени.
1
ответ
Проблема с часовым поясом django в поле формы
Объект постороннего ключа, который я использую в форме модели, отображается следующим образом в шаблоне: Он показывает дату и время в UTC, который является часовым поясом по умолчанию. Он должен показывать информацию о дате, локализованную в часовом…
31 май '12 в 21:21
1
ответ
Почему pytz.country_timezones('cn') в системе centos имеют другой результат?
Два компьютера устанавливают Centos 6.5, ядро 3.10.44, имеют разные результаты. один результат [u'Asia/Shanghai', u'Asia/Urumqi']а другой ['Asia/Shanghai', 'Asia/Harbin', 'Asia/Chongqing', 'Asia/Urumqi', 'Asia/Kashgar'], Есть ли конфиг, который де…
19 апр '16 в 09:55
2
ответа
Ошибка проверки формы в Django - pytz и выборы
Я пытаюсь позволить пользователю установить, в каком часовом поясе он находится, однако проверка формы .is_valid() терпит неудачу и не может понять, почему. Значение часового пояса для пользователя сохраняется в модели профиля. С помощью ChoiceField…
17 июн '17 в 04:07
3
ответа
Проверка, если строка даты в формате UTC
У меня есть строка даты типа "2011-11-06 14:00:00+00:00". Есть ли способ проверить это в формате UTC или нет? Я попытался преобразовать вышеупомянутую строку в объект datetime, используя utc = datetime.strptime('2011-11-06 14:00:00+00:00','%Y-%m-%d …
15 июл '11 в 15:19
2
ответа
Проблема с импортом модуля pytz после обновления
Я недавно обновился с Python 2.7.6 до 2.7.12. В моем коде 2.7.6 (который работал) у меня был следующий импорт: from pytz import timezone def get_curr_time(): pst = timezone('US/Pacific') cur_time = datetime.now(pst) return cur_time.strftime('%Y-%m-%…
23 окт '16 в 22:17
1
ответ
Python получает начало недели в соответствии с часовым поясом / языковым стандартом
Я хочу знать, какое начало недели, но это должно быть в соответствии с конкретным часовым поясом или локалью. Я могу получить дату и время начала дня, как это now = datetime.now() weekday = now.weekday() # 0 if it is Monday start_of_week = now.repla…
19 июн '17 в 11:00
4
ответа
Python: Как вы конвертируете дату / время из одного часового пояса в другой?
В частности, учитывая часовой пояс моего сервера (системное время) и ввод часового пояса, как рассчитать системное время, как если бы оно было в этом новом часовом поясе (независимо от перехода на летнее время и т. Д.)? import datetime current_time …
13 авг '15 в 00:23
3
ответа
Потеря информации о летнем времени с помощью преобразований pytz и UTC
Может быть, это ошибка 4 утра, но я думаю, что я все делаю правильно, но не похоже, что DST переводит метку времени UTC в локализованную дату и время. >>> from datetime import datetime >>> import pytz >>> eastern = pytz.ti…
16 июн '13 в 10:06
1
ответ
Получить случайное время с учетом даты и времени в Python
Я получаю случайное время между двумя датами со следующим кодом start_date = datetime.datetime(2013, 1, 1, tzinfo=pytz.UTC).toordinal() end_date = datetime.datetime.now(tz=pytz.utc).toordinal() return datetime.date.fromordinal(random.randint(start_d…
06 июн '15 в 12:22
1
ответ
Получение текущей даты в определенном часовом поясе Джанго
Я хочу получить текущую дату для определенного часового пояса в моем приложении Django, независимо от часового пояса сервера. Я сохраняю часовой пояс пользователя в базе данных. Затем я буду использовать это в следующей функции: def current_date(zon…
29 май '16 в 18:07
2
ответа
Странное поведение pytz и datetime - возможная ошибка?
Я получаю следующий вывод. Это предполагаемое поведение pytz? Кстати, я живу в американском / восточном часовом поясе. Почему EST дает -04:56 в качестве смещения часового пояса? import datetime import pytz a = datetime.datetime.now() tz_est = pytz.t…
17 мар '17 в 02:58
0
ответов
Django ORM возвращает часовой пояс, не зная дату и время
У меня дорогой запрос, который я хотел бы кэшировать, но я получаю следующую ошибку: query = MyModel.objects.all().annotate( max_time=Max(Case(When(m2mthrough__somebool=True, then=F('m2mthrough__rel1__rel2__sometime')), output_field=models.DateTimeF…
14 авг '18 в 20:25
1
ответ
Проверьте, находится ли datetime.datetime в летнее время с помощью функции.dst(), не возвращающей значение в часовом поясе pytz
Я пытаюсь проверить, находится ли произвольно локализованный объект даты и времени в летнее время или нет. Это аналогичный вопрос, который многие уже задавали. например. ( Летнее время в Python) В этих платах способ проверить, находится ли datetime …
17 авг '17 в 13:29
1
ответ
Python: как преобразовать временную метку с учетом часового пояса в UTC, не зная, действует ли DST
Я пытаюсь преобразовать наивную временную метку, которая всегда в тихоокеанском времени, в время UTC. В приведенном ниже коде я могу указать, что у меня есть метка времени по тихоокеанскому времени, но, похоже, она не знает, что она должна быть смещ…
22 окт '13 в 20:09
4
ответа
Правильное преобразование между tz незнающим временем, UTC и работой с часовыми поясами в python
У меня есть строка в форме '20111014T090000' со связанным идентификатором часового пояса (TZID=America/Los_Angeles), и я хочу преобразовать это время в UTC в секундах с соответствующим смещением. Кажется, проблема в том, что мое время вывода отключе…
27 сен '11 в 00:20
0
ответов
MemoryError при установке tzwhere
На AWS EC2 я клонировал pytzwhere, используя: sudo git clone --recursive https://github.com/pegler/pytzwhere.git Затем я попытался установить его с помощью Python 2.7 и: sudo python setup.py install К сожалению, это останавливается со следующей ошиб…
01 янв '16 в 23:36
1
ответ
Как создать объект datetime для определенного времени в часовом поясе в django
У меня есть время, когда я хочу, чтобы пользователям напомнили, когда это время наступит в их часовом поясе. Хранится как поле времени: reminder = models.TimeField(blank=True, null=True) У меня есть часовой пояс, связанный с каждым пользователем. Эт…
03 сен '14 в 23:10
1
ответ
Django UnknownTimeZoneError
Недавно я играл с google app engine и установил версию pytz для GAE (точнее, gaepytz-2011h-py2.7). Когда я пытаюсь открыть моего администратора для проекта Django, я получаю вышеупомянутую ошибку с этой трассировкой: gaepytz-2011h-py2.7.egg/pytz/__i…
28 мар '13 в 20:17
2
ответа
Как добавить часовой пояс к объекту datetime.datetime?
У меня есть datetime.datetime объект (datetime.datetime(2014, 4, 11, 18, 0)) и я хотел бы назначить ему часовой пояс, используя pytz, Я знаю, что вы можете использовать pytz с datetime.datetime.now() объект (datetime.datetime.now(pytz.timezone('Amer…
12 апр '14 в 01:32
3
ответа
Как получить общее название для часового пояса pytz, например. EST/EDT для Америки / Нью-Йорк
Учитывая временную зону pytz для конкретного пользователя (рассчитанную по его смещению), я хочу отобразить общее имя для этого часового пояса. Я предполагаю, что люди более привыкли видеть EST или PST, а не прописывать, как Америка / Нью-Йорк. Pytz…
10 май '11 в 07:17